Practical Application

Vasupujya, revered as the 12th Tirthankara in Jain tradition, is a symbol of purity, wisdom, and compassion. His teachings inspire the path of non-violence, truth, and spiritual discipline, guiding seekers towards inner awakening and liberation. Vasupujya’s life and philosophy emphasize detachment from material desires and devotion to the eternal values of peace and harmony.
